Timing Chain Lever Guide for Mazda Engines

This precision chain control lever keeps the timing ⛓️ tight and straight. It supports the chain against the tensioner and guide, so cams and crank stay in sync. Built for daily use and high revs, it prevents slap, rattle, and jump during cold starts and hard pulls.

Why this part is needed

Proper chain control protects valve timing, power, and fuel economy. With a healthy lever, the chain runs true, wear is low, and noise stays minimal. It also helps the hydraulic tensioner hold pressure after shutdown.

How it works

A hardened arm with a low-friction pad rides the chain. Oil-fed tension pushes the arm, taking up slack as the chain stretches with miles. The lever’s arc and surface keep load even across links for stable timing.

When the lever fails ⚠️

Expect cold-start rattle, rough idle, misfire, poor MPG, and possible CEL for timing correlation. Severe wear can let the chain skip a toothβ€”bent valves or no-start. Metal or plastic debris may appear in the oil.

Tech notes

Replace with chain, guides, and tensioner as a set when noise appears. Torque pivots to spec and prime the tensioner. Use quality oil to reduce pad glazing. After install, verify marks and learn procedure if required βœ….
